Fijiana 7s outclassed by Australia going down 31-12

The Fiji Airways Fijiana 7s team remain winless in the HSBC Madrid 7s after they were beaten 31-12 by a classy Australian side.

Lavena Cavuru scored the lone try for Fiji in the first half.

Speedster Madison Levi scored a hattrick, while Charlotte Caslick made a brilliant line break to score five points putting Australia in the lead at half time 24-7.

Kaitlin Shave scored first for Australia in the second half.

The Fijiana managed to stage a late fightback, resulting in Younis Bese scoring in the 13th minute, but it was a little to late.

They will now face Ireland in their final pool match at 1:05 tomorrow morning.

In other matches South Africa thrashed Belgium 40-7, USA edged Canada 26-19, New Zealand beat Great Britain 49-14 and France defeated Ireland 31-5.

Meanwhile the women's cup semi finals kick off at 9:33pm tomorrow, while the cup final will be played at 5:49 Monday morning.
